"""Test default charm events such as install, etc."""
from unittest.mock import Mock, patch
from charm import SlurmctldCharm
from ops.model import BlockedStatus
from ops.testing import Harness
from pyfakefs.fake_filesystem_unittest import TestCase
from charms.hpc_libs.v0.slurm_ops import SlurmOpsError
class TestCharm(TestCase):
def setUp(self):
self.harness = Harness(SlurmctldCharm)
self.addCleanup(self.harness.cleanup)
self.setUpPyfakefs()
self.harness.begin()
def test_cluster_name(self) -> None:
"""Test that the _cluster_name property works."""
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m._cluster_name, "osd-cluster")
def test_cluster_info(self) -> None:
"""Test the cluster_info property works."""
self.assertEqual(type(self.harness.charm._cluster_name), str)
def test_is_slurm_installed(self) -> None:
"""Test that the is_slurm_installed method works."""
setattr(self.harness.charm._stored, "slurm_installed", True) # Patch StoredState
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m.slurm_installed, True)
def test_is_slurm_not_installed(self) -> None:
"""Test that the is_slurm_installed method works when slurm is not installed."""
setattr(self.harness.charm._stored, "slurm_installed", False) # Patch StoredState
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m.slurm_installed, False)
@patch("charm.SlurmctldCharm._on_write_slurm_conf")
@patch("ops.framework.EventBase.defer")
def test_install_success(self, defer, *_) -> None:
"""Test `InstallEvent` hook when slurmctld installation succeeds."""
self.harness.set_leader(True)
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.install = Mock()
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.version = Mock(return_value="24.05.2-1")
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.jwt = Mock()
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.jwt.get.return_value = "=X="
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.munge = Mock()
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.munge.key.get.return_value = "=X="
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.exporter = Mock()
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.service = Mock()
self.harness.charm.on.install.emit()
defer.assert_not_called()
@patch("ops.framework.EventBase.defer")
def test_install_fail_ha_support(self, defer) -> None:
"""Test `InstallEvent` hook when multiple slurmctld units are deployed.
Notes:
The slurmctld charm currently does not support high-availability so this
unit test validates that we properly handle if multiple slurmctld units
are deployed.
"""
self.harness.set_leader(False)
self.harness.charm.on.install.emit()
defer.assert_called()
self.assertEqual(
self.harness.charm.unit.status,
BlockedStatus("slurmctld high-availability not supported"),
)
@patch("ops.framework.EventBase.defer")
def test_install_fail_slurmctld_package(self, defer) -> None:
"""Test `InstallEvent` hook when slurmctld fails to install."""
self.harness.set_leader(True)
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.install = Mock(
side_effect=SlurmOpsError("failed to install slurmctld")
)
self.harness.charm.on.install.emit()
defer.assert_called()
self.assertEqual(
self.harness.charm.unit.status,
BlockedStatus("failed to install slurmctld. see logs for further details"),
)
def test_update_status_slurm_not_installed(self) -> None:
"""Test `UpdateStatusEvent` hook when slurmctld is not installed."""
self.harness.charm.on.update_status.emit()
self.assertEqual(
self.harness.charm.unit.status,
BlockedStatus("failed to install slurmctld. see logs for further details"),
)
def test_get_munge_key(self) -> None:
"""Test that the get_munge_key method works."""
setattr(self.harness.charm._stored, "munge_key", "=ABC=") # Patch StoredState
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m.get_munge_key(), "=ABC=")
def test_get_jwt_rsa(self) -> None:
"""Test that the get_jwt_rsa method works."""
setattr(self.harness.charm._stored, "jwt_rsa", "=ABC=") # Patch StoredState
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m.get_jwt_rsa(), "=ABC=")
@patch("charm.SlurmctldCharm._check_status", return_value=False)
def test_on_slurmrestd_available_status_false(self, _) -> None:
"""Test that the on_slurmrestd_available method works when _check_status is False."""
self.harness.charm._slurmrestd.on.slurmrestd_available.emit()
@patch("charm.SlurmctldCharm._check_status", return_value=False)
@patch("interface_slurmrestd.Slurmrestd.set_slurm_config_on_app_relation_data")
@patch("ops.framework.EventBase.defer")
def test_on_slurmrestd_available_no_config(self, defer, *_) -> None:
"""Test that the on_slurmrestd_available method works if no slurm config is available."""
self.harness.set_leader(True)
self.harness.charm._slurmrestd.on.slurmrestd_available.emit()
defer.assert_called()
@patch("charm.SlurmctldCharm._check_status", return_value=True)
@patch("slurmutils.editors.slurmconfig.load")
@patch("interface_slurmrestd.Slurmrestd.set_slurm_config_on_app_relation_data")
def test_on_slurmrestd_available_if_available(self, *_) -> None:
"""Test that the on_slurmrestd_available method works if slurm_config is available.
Notes:
This method is testing the _on_slurmrestd_available event handler
completes successfully.
"""
self.harness.charm._stored.slurmrestd_available = True
self.harness.charm._slurmrestd.on.slurmrestd_available.emit()
def test_on_slurmdbd_available(self) -> None:
"""Test that the on_slurmdbd_method works."""
self.harness.charm._slurmdbd.on.slurmdbd_available.emit("slurmdbdhost")
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m._stored.slurmdbd_host, "slurmdbdhost")
def test_on_slurmdbd_unavailable(self) -> None:
"""Test that the on_slurmdbd_unavailable method works."""
self.harness.charm._slurmdbd.on.slurmdbd_unavailable.emit()
self.assertEqual(self.harness.charm._stored.slurmdbd_host, "")
@patch("charm.is_container", return_value=True)
def test_get_user_supplied_parameters(self, *_) -> None:
"""Test that user supplied parameters are parsed correctly."""
self.harness.add_relation("slurmd", "slurmd")
self.harness.add_relation("slurmctld-peer", self.harness.charm.app.name)
self.harness.update_config(
{"slurm-conf-parameters": "JobAcctGatherFrequency=task=30,network=40"}
)
self.assertEqual(
self.harness.charm._assemble_slurm_conf().job_acct_gather_frequency,
"task=30,network=40",
)
def test_resume_nodes_valid_input(self) -> None:
"""Test that the _resume_nodes method provides a valid scontrol command."""
self.harness.charm._slurmctld.scontrol = Mock()
self.harness.charm._resume_nodes(["juju-123456-1", "tester-node", "node-three"])
args, _ = self.harness.charm._slurmctld.scontrol.call_args
self.assertEqual(
args, ("update", "nodename=juju-123456-1,tester-node,node-three", "state=resume")
)
